
DS-gluten free love a food fair!
Posted on the 25/01/2012 by
DS-gluten free jump at the chance to meet our customers face to face and see people try our tasty gluten free foods. Last year we travelled all over the UK to attend a number of gluten free food fairs. Amongst many we visited York, Penrith, Melksham and Ellesmere Port and the good news is this year will be no different!
The regular gluten free events are hosted by Coeliac UK, the charity who make it their mission to raise awareness of coeliac disease. These events occur across the country, we’ve listed the dates and locations of the ones we’ll be attending up to May, so you can find your nearest gluten free food fair!
